Our Sticking Process in Petteridge

  1. 1

    Check the wall for damp, soundness, and flatness before boarding

  2. 2

    Mark out and apply adhesive dabs to the wall in the correct pattern and spacing

  3. 3

    Offer up and press plasterboard sheets against the dabs, checking level and plumb

  4. 4

    Pack out any low spots and allow the adhesive to cure

  5. 5

    Joint the boards and finish with a skim coat once secure

Sticking, also called dot-and-dab, is a drylining method where plasterboard is fixed directly to a solid masonry wall using adhesive dabs instead of a timber or metal frame. It straightens an uneven solid wall in Petteridge ready for skimming, while keeping the loss of room space to a minimum.
